  2. Hi VJ.

    My partner and I have officially gotten a case complete and have a scheduled interview. It's been such a long wait. I've been here since end of May, and cannot wait to move back to the USA with my husband.

    I wanted to know how can I actually move up our interview date. I know DCF filers are able to manually add in an interview date, and those of us going through USCIS and NVC are given a date. However, a DCF'er told me they moved up their interview date when a cancellation or another appointment became available. Through USTravelDocs I input our VAC appointment, we finished that. We're going to complete medical next, just getting him vaccinated somewhere more affordable first (tomorrow). So Medical will happen this coming week.

    We have all of our paperwork. How can I move up our date? It's scheduled for November 18, 2015. However, I just logged into USTravelDocs and it said, "Earliest available appointment, October 16, 2015." Being able to interview a month earlier would be amazing! I just don't know how to input a new interview date. The button showing available dates only shows up sometimes when I log in. Not all the time. It also isn't a clickable feature (from what I've gathered). Does anyone have any experience or advice with this? I don't want to screw up our original interview date and get myself in a mess.
